What Are Impact Garage Doors?
Impact garage doors are specially designed enclosures constructed to withstand high-velocity winds, airborne debris, and extreme pressure differentials that occur during major storms and hurricanes. Unlike standard garage doors, which often buckle under storm pressure, impact-rated doors undergo rigorous certification against Florida Product Approval requirements.
What goes into making impact garage doors sets them apart at a fundamental design level. Most impact-rated garage doors feature reinforced steel or aluminum panels combined with reinforced strut systems that prevent the door from bowing under both push and pull forces. The hardware, tracks, and springs are also upgraded to support the door's structural performance.
In addition to hurricane resistance, impact garage doors also function as a buffer against heat transfer, limiting thermal transfer during South Florida's hot summers. Several product lines feature polyurethane foam panels that improve energy efficiency significantly. Combined with their wind resistance, this makes impact garage doors an exceptionally practical upgrade options available to Florida homeowners.
The Advantages of Impact Garage Doors
- Hurricane and Wind Protection — Impact garage doors are engineered to meet Florida's state-mandated product approval standards, providing verified protection when severe weather arrives.
- Debris Impact Resistance — Heavy-duty construction throughout prevent damage from wind-driven projectiles including items carried by high-velocity winds.
- Lower Homeowner's Insurance Costs — A number of insurers in the state give substantial savings for properties with certified impact protection, making the upgrade to deliver a financial return.
- Lower Cooling Costs — Insulated impact garage doors reduce heat transfer into your garage and adjacent living spaces, enabling your cooling equipment to work less and cost less.
- Enhanced Home Security — The identical structural features that handles wind loads also adds a serious layer of security than ordinary door systems.
- Exterior Noise Control — Thickened door construction absorb street noise, wind sound, and the outside world meaningfully.
- Curb Appeal and Design Options — Impact garage doors come in a wide range of architectural styles and surface treatments suitable for any home design.
- Long-Term Durability and Value — Properly installed impact garage doors often perform for decades requiring very little upkeep, adding measurable value to your home.
The Impact Garage Doors Procedure Step by Step
- Initial Consultation and Site Evaluation — A specialist from STS Impact Windows & Doors visits your home to measure the opening, evaluate your current setup, and talk through which impact door models fit your needs. This appointment confirms accurate product ordering and project planning.
- Product Selection and Permitting — Using the information gathered on-site, our experts assist you in choosing the appropriate impact-rated product certified for your area's storm exposure. We then submit building department filings on your behalf.
- Removal of the Existing Door — When your project day arrives, our team carefully extracts your current door system including all attached parts. Our installers then check the frame for any structural issues, rot, or damage that must be corrected before proceeding.
- Track and Hardware System Installation — All mechanical components — tracks, springs, and operators are installed and calibrated according to the manufacturer's specifications. Correct hardware installation is essential for maintaining the impact rating in practice.
- Panel Installation and Alignment — The reinforced door sections are fitted one panel at a time and attached to the operating mechanism. Interior bracing elements are attached to each panel to meet the door's certified wind-load specification.
- Installing Weather Seals and Bottom Threshold — Storm-rated sealing systems are installed along the top, sides, and bottom of the door opening. A heavy-duty bottom seal is added at the floor level to prevent water intrusion when rainfall is severe.
- Operational Check and Client Review — After the door is fully installed, our technicians operate the door repeatedly to verify balance and performance. Balance, auto-reverse function, and operator performance before wrapping up prior to project completion. We walk you through the system of the new door's features.

Impact Garage Doors Frequently Asked Questions
What is the typical timeline for a standard impact door project require?
Most residential impact garage door installations are completed within one full day from removal of the old door to completion and cleanup. Larger openings, double doors, or custom-ordered panels may require additional time.
How much do impact garage doors usually run for most residential installations?
Investment amounts for impact-rated garage doors varies based on door size, panel style, insulation level, and associated hardware selections. A typical residential customer sees project costs ranging from $1,800 to $5,500 for a complete supply-and-install project. Specialty finishes or custom finishes may cost more.
Are impact garage doors require me to leave my home during the process?
Installation involves standard construction noise such as drilling, metal cutting, and fastening but is not unusually disruptive. You do not need to vacate your home during the installation. Your garage area needs to be accessible and clear of vehicles and stored items.
What is the expected lifespan of a properly installed impact garage door?
A quality impact garage door set up by an experienced crew often exceed 20 years of reliable service with minimal upkeep. Annual lubrication of moving parts combined with timely handling of any hardware wear or seal damage extends the door's usable life considerably.
Can impact doors work with my existing garage door operator?
These door systems are generally more substantial in weight than ordinary products due to their reinforced panel construction. In many cases, an upgraded operator system should be paired with the door so the door opens and closes correctly. A site review will determine the current operator as part of the project scope.
